Find & Apply For Case Worker Jobs In Jefferson, Louisiana

Case Worker jobs in Jefferson, Louisiana involve providing assistance to clients in need, conducting assessments, developing treatment plans, and connecting individuals with essential services. Responsibilities also include maintaining detailed records, collaborating with other professionals, and advocating for clients. These roles require strong communication skills, empathy, and a commitment to social justice. Below you can find different Case Worker positions in Jefferson, Louisiana.

Salary Information & Job Trends In this Region

Case Workers in Jefferson, Louisiana play a vital role in managing client cases and providing support for individuals and families in need. - Entry-level Case Worker salaries range from $30,000 to $40,000 per year - Mid-career Case Manager salaries range from $40,000 to $55,000 per year - Senior Case Director salaries range from $55,000 to $75,000 per year The profession of Case Workers in Jefferson, Louisiana began as a community-based initiative to address social issues and provide support to vulnerable populations. Over the years, these roles have become essential in navigating public health, welfare systems, and legal aid. Since its inception, the role of the Case Worker has seen significant changes, particularly in the areas of specialization and professional certification. The expansion of social services has required Case Workers to develop expertise in specific areas such as child welfare, mental health, and substance abuse. Recent trends in case work in Jefferson include the use of digital tools for case management, an increased focus on interdisciplinary approaches, and a greater emphasis on preventative measures within the community to reduce long-term dependency on social services.
